How to Change Your Address and Update Important Contacts

Whether you are moving to a new city, state, or even just down the street, it is essential to update your address with various organizations, contacts, and services to avoid disruptions in communication and service. This report outlines the necessary steps to effectively change your address and update important contacts.

Step 1: Create a Checklist

Before initiating the address change process, it is helpful to create a checklist of all the entities that need to be notified. Common organizations include:

  1. Government Agencies: This includes the postal service, tax agencies, and local government offices.
  2. Financial Institutions: Banks, credit unions, and credit card companies should be informed to ensure that your financial statements and important documents reach you.
  3. Healthcare Providers: Notify your doctors, dentists, and any other healthcare providers to ensure continuity of care.
  4. Utility Companies: Inform your gas, electricity, water, internet, and cable providers to transfer services to your new address.
  5. Insurance Providers: Update your address with health, auto, home, and life insurance companies.
  6. Subscriptions and Memberships: Update your address for any magazines, online subscriptions, or memberships.
  7. Friends and Family: Don’t forget to inform your personal contacts to keep them updated.

Step 2: Notify the Postal Service

One of the first steps in changing your address is to notify your local postal service. In the United States, you can do this through the United States Postal Service (USPS) by completing a change of address form online or in person at your local post office. This service will forward your mail to your new address for a specified period, typically 12 months, allowing you to catch any missed updates from organizations that you may have forgotten to notify.

Step 3: Update Your Address with Government Agencies

Next, you should update your address with relevant government agencies. This typically includes the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) for your driver’s license and vehicle registration, as well as the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) for tax purposes. Each agency has its own procedures for updating your address, so be sure to follow their specific guidelines.

Step 4: Contact Financial Institutions

Reach out to your bank and credit card companies to update your address. This is crucial for receiving bank statements, checks, and other important financial correspondence. Many banks offer online banking options that allow you to change your address quickly and securely.

Step 5: Notify Healthcare Providers

Contact your healthcare providers to update your address in their records. This ensures that medical bills, appointment reminders, and other important communications are sent to your new address. You may also want to check if you need to update your insurance information.

Step 6: Update Utilities and Services

Contact your utility companies to transfer services to your new address. It is advisable to do this a few weeks in advance to ensure a smooth transition without interruptions in service. Additionally, update any service subscriptions such as internet, cable, and phone services.

Step 7: Inform Personal Contacts

Finally, inform your friends and family of your new address. This can be done through personal messages, social media, or even sending out a change of address card.

By following these steps, you can ensure that your address is updated seamlessly across all important contacts and organizations, minimizing the risk of missed communications and services.
